Расшифровка Текста
Что такое расшифровка текста?
Расшифровка текста преобразует зашифрованные данные обратно в их исходный простой текст с использованием криптографических алгоритмов и правильного ключа расшифровки. Для симметричного шифрования (AES) вы используете тот же секретный ключ, который был использован для шифрования. Для асимметричного шифрования (RSA) вы используете закрытый ключ, соответствующий открытому ключу, использованному для шифрования.
Supported Algorithms:
Symmetric Decryption (AES):
- AES-GCM (Recommended): Provides authenticated encryption with associated data (AEAD). Most secure for general use.
- AES-CBC: Traditional block cipher mode. Requires padding.
- AES-CTR: Counter mode. Converts block cipher to stream cipher.
Asymmetric Decryption (RSA):
- RSA-OAEP: Uses private key for decryption. Requires the corresponding private key to the public key used for encryption.
Expected Input Format:
For AES algorithms: JSON with base64-encoded components
{"iv": "base64_encoded_iv", "data": "base64_encoded_ciphertext"}
Also supports legacy hex format:
{"iv": "hex_encoded_iv", "data": "hex_encoded_ciphertext"}
For RSA: Base64-encoded ciphertext only
base64_encoded_ciphertext
Как использовать инструмент Расшифровка Текста
-
Вставьте ваши зашифрованные данные в поле ввода (формат JSON с iv и data для AES или base64 для RSA).
-
Выберите алгоритм, который был использован для шифрования.
-
Для AES: Введите секретный ключ, который был использован для шифрования.
-
Для RSA: Вставьте ваш закрытый ключ в формате PEM.
-
Расшифрованный текст автоматически отображается по мере ввода.
-
Скопируйте расшифрованный результат для использования в вашем приложении.
Additional Tips:
- For AES: Use the same secret key that was used for encryption
- For RSA: You need the private key corresponding to the public key used for encryption
- Automatic format detection: The tool automatically detects base64 or hex encoding
- Error handling: If decryption fails, check that you're using the correct algorithm and key
Примечания по безопасности
Этот инструмент использует родную Web Crypto API браузера для безопасной расшифровки. Вся расшифровка происходит локально в вашем браузере - данные или ключи никогда не отправляются на внешние серверы. Убедитесь, что используете правильный алгоритм и ключ, соответствующие методу шифрования. Инструмент поддерживает форматы кодирования base64 (стандартный) и hex (устаревший) для зашифрованных данных AES.
Important Notes:
- All decryption happens locally in your browser using the Web Crypto API
- Your private keys and secrets never leave your browser
- For RSA decryption, you decrypt with a private key; the data was encrypted with the corresponding public key
- Keep your private keys and secret keys secure - they are the only way to decrypt your data
- The tool supports both base64 (standard) and hex (legacy) encoding formats
Этот бесплатный онлайн-инструмент расшифровки текста быстрый, безопасный и работает полностью в вашем браузере. Вся расшифровка выполняется локально с использованием Web Crypto API - данные не отправляются на серверы. Идеально подходит для разработчиков, специалистов по безопасности и всех, кому нужно расшифровать текстовые данные, зашифрованные алгоритмами AES или RSA.
Keywords: расшифровка текста онлайн, расшифровка AES, расшифровать текст, AES-GCM, AES-CBC, AES-CTR, RSA-OAEP, безопасная расшифровка текста, бесплатный инструмент расшифровки, расшифровка Web Crypto API, клиентская расшифровка